Job: a group of related activities and duties: position: specific duties and responsibilities performed by only one employee, work: tasks or activities that need to be completed. Job analysis: process of obtaining information about jobs by determining the duties, tasks, or activities and the skills, knowledge, and abilities associated with the jobs. Job specifications: statement of the needed knowledge, skills, and abilities of the person who is to perform the position. The different duties and responsibilities performed by only one employee: standards of performance: set out the expected results of the job. Chapter 7: direct compensation: employee wages and salaries, incentives, bonuses, and commissions. Job evaluation system: job ranking system, job classification, point system, factor comparison system.
